Commonwealth Consolidated Acts(1) A person must not use an eligible communications service in the course of carrying on a credit reporting business unless the person is a corporation.
(2) A person must not:
(a) in the course of trade or commerce:
(i) between Australia and places outside Australia; or
(ii) among the States; or
(iii) between a State and a Territory; or
(iv) among the Territories; or
(b) in the course of banking (other than State banking not extending beyond the limits of the State concerned); or
(c) in the course of insurance business (other than insurance business relating to State insurance not extending beyond the limits of the State concerned); or
(d) in a Territory;
carry on a credit reporting business unless the person is a corporation.
(3) A person must not act on a corporation's behalf in the course of carrying on a credit reporting business unless the person is a corporation.
(4) A person who intentionally contravenes this section is guilty of an offence punishable, on conviction, by a fine not exceeding $30,000.
